In this article, we will explore various options available that simplify the rendering process while providing impressive results.Top Easiest Rendering SoftwareHere are some of the most accessible rendering software tools that cater to different needs and skill levels:1. SketchUpSketchUp is renowned for its intuitive interface, making it an excellent choice for beginners. With drag-and-drop functionality and a vast library of plugins, it allows designers to create 3D models effortlessly. The basic version is free, and the Pro version offers advanced features for a fee.2. LumionLumion is another user-friendly software that allows for real-time rendering. Its powerful engine enables designers to create stunning visuals without a steep learning curve. With a plethora of pre-built assets, you can quickly populate your designs and showcase them with realistic lighting and effects.3. BlenderBlender is a free, open-source software that has gained popularity among designers for its flexibility and capabilities. While it can be complex, many resources and tutorials are available that simplify the learning process. Its rendering engine, Cycles, produces high-quality images and animations.4. CoohomCoohom focuses on ease of use with its cloud-based platform, allowing users to create and render designs without the need for powerful hardware. Its drag-and-drop interface and ready-to-use templates are perfect for those who want quick results without sacrificing quality.Features to Look for in Rendering SoftwareWhen choosing the easiest rendering software, consider the following features:User Interface: Look for software with a clean, simple interface that doesn’t overwhelm you with options.Rendering Speed: Fast rendering times can save you hours in the design process.Asset Libraries: A robust library of pre-made objects and materials can enhance your designs quickly.Tutorials and Support: Access to tutorials can ease the learning curve significantly.ConclusionChoosing the right rendering software can make a significant difference in your design process. Whether you opt for SketchUp, Lumion, Blender, or Coohom, each offers unique features that cater to different levels of expertise.
